The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1978 Formosa Center Cockpit offers a blend of classic design and sturdy construction, making it a popular choice among vintage sailboat enthusiasts.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Solid Build Quality: Known for its robust fiberglass construction, the Formosa Center Cockpit is durable and able to handle various sea conditions.
Center Cockpit Design: Provides excellent visibility and protection from the elements, enhancing comfort and safety during sailing.
Spacious Interior: For a boat of its size and era, it offers a surprisingly roomy cabin with practical layout, suitable for extended cruising.
Classic Aesthetic: The timeless design appeals to those who appreciate traditional sailboat styling.
Good Stability: The hull design offers stable handling and a comfortable ride, even in choppy waters.
Cons
Older Systems: Being a 1978 model, some of the onboard systems and fittings may be outdated and could require upgrades or maintenance.
Weight: The sturdy construction results in a heavier boat, which may impact speed and maneuverability compared to more modern, lighter designs.
Limited Modern Amenities: Lacks some of the conveniences found in newer vessels, such as advanced electronics and contemporary interior finishes.
Maintenance Requirements: As with any classic boat, ongoing care and potential restoration work can be time-consuming and costly.
Availability of Parts: Finding replacement parts specific to this model might pose challenges due to its age.
